  • 1996 SP Electrical Starting Problem

    hey guys, first off thanks for readin this.

    anyways, 96 sp. it wont start or even make an attempt to start. the starter isnt clicking either. battery is perfect, been checking it with a volt meter. engine isnt seized up either. and there IS NOT electrical current going to the starter. so were thinking maybe a fuse? if so, where the hell is the fuse box?!

    we have been tinkering with it for a while now, and we cant figure out the problem. the last time we put it up, was the 4th of july. and it started and ran JUST fine. anybody have any ideas?

    do you have any power to the gauges?? If so, then it sounds like your starter solenoid is shot.. It's in the black square box, where your spark plug wires go..

    You have fuses in that black box, as well as the grey box on the left side of the gas tank.

        OH.. SP!! I thought you had an XP..

        Okay, it's all in the grey box, next to the tank. To remove that box, all you have to do is un hook the positive on the battery, unplug the plug wires and temp sensor and (if your ski has it) unplug the mag harness on the front cover area.

        There is a little latch on the grey box mount, on the front of it (by the tank, in the nose). Pull that slightly and the box will come loose. You will have to lift the box and rotate it vertically so that the plug wires are now facing the nose of the ski.. You can then set it on top of the gas tank and open it from there.

        It's a pain to open, be careful not to break a latch on the box...
